Travel restrictions have changed constantly since the pandemic began in 2020, but one of the most consistent rules until recently was filling out a passenger locator form. The form was introduced in 2020 as a way to keep track of those returning to the UK in case they tested positive for Covid, or came into contact with someone who did. Visit website
If you’re travelling to Finland, Ireland, Northern Ireland, Norway or Malta, your dog will need tapeworm treatment. With some exceptions, you can’t travel with more than five pets. If you’re travelling to a non-EU country, you’ll need to fill in an export application form, and get an export health certificate. For more information ... Visit website
